संदर्भ में पढ़ें20 ASTRONOMY IN ANCIENT NATIONS facts, as Biot has shown from the Ptolemy's numerical data that the deviation of the line of apsides reaches its maximum value of ± 13° 8′ .9 in elongations 90° ∓ 32° 57′.5.¹ But it must be acknowledged that the words in question are also used very vaguely, e. g. by Abu 'l Wefa himself, who says that the velocity of the superior planets after emerging from the Sun's rays dimi- nishes gradually till their distance from the Sun is about a tathlith, when they become stationary. It looks almost as if these words might be used to denote any elongation outside syzygy and quadrature.² If Abu 'l Wefa had made a new discovery, we should have expected later Arabian astronomers to have alluded to it. But not one of them gives anything but interpretations of the lunar theory of Ptolemy, and in expressions very similar to those employed by Abu 'l Wefa. Attention was at once called to this fact, and Isaac Israeli of Toledo (about 1310) and Geber of Seville were quoted as examples,³ though it would, of course, have been quite possible for these two writers to have remained ignorant of whatever progress astronomy might have made in the school of Baghdad. But this objection does not apply to Nasir ed-din al Tusi, in whose review of the Almagest and Mem- orial of Astronomy the inequalities known to Ptolemy and no others, are described and credited to Ptolemy⁴; not to Mahamud al Jagmini (about 1300) , who wrote a compendium (mulachchas)
